About Yeovil Marsh
Yeovil Marsh is a small village located in Somerset, England, within the postcode area BA21. It lies to the north of the larger town of Yeovil and is primarily residential, offering a peaceful environment for its inhabitants. The village is surrounded by agricultural land, which contributes to its rural character.
Local amenities are limited, but residents can access essential services in nearby Yeovil. The area is well-connected by road, making it convenient for those commuting to the town or further afield. Yeovil Marsh is also close to various walking routes, allowing for exploration of the surrounding countryside and the natural landscape of Somerset.

Household Income in Yeovil Marsh ONS 2023
The average total household income in Yeovil Marsh is approximately £51,006 a year before tax, 8% below the national average of £55,302. After tax and benefits, the average disposable (net) household income is around £38,970. These are modelled estimates from the Office for National Statistics for the financial year ending 2023.

Businesses in Yeovil Marsh ONS 2025
There are approximately 714 active businesses based in Yeovil Marsh, around 21 for every 1,000 residents. The local economy is dominated by small firms: about 85% are micro-businesses employing fewer than 10 people, while 16 are larger employers with 50 or more staff. Figures are from the Office for National Statistics UK Business Counts.

Home Ownership in Yeovil Marsh
Of the 14,666 households in and around Yeovil Marsh, 60% are owned, 20% are socially rented and 20% are privately rented. Home ownership here is lower than the England and Wales average of 63%.
Tenure from the 2021 Census (ONS), for the postcode districts covering Yeovil Marsh.
